A surprising amount of information can be inferred about a person from just a phone number, email address, and spending habits. A phone number can reveal a person’s name, city or region, carrier, and sometimes even social media accounts or the types of services they use. An email address can link to online accounts, social media profiles, work or school affiliations, and past data breaches, and even the format of the email can give clues about a person’s identity. Spending habits can indicate income range, interests, age group, life stage, and financial stability. When these pieces of information are combined, it becomes easier to identify someone, understand their routines, and target them with advertisements. However, this data alone usually cannot reveal sensitive details like bank balances, passwords, or private messages. To protect privacy, it’s important to limit the sharing of emails and phone numbers, use strong privacy settings on social media, avoid reusing the same email everywhere, and be cautious of apps or services asking for unnecessary personal information.
